Description
To allow for collection of items outside of feeds by pulling from a 3rd party feed.
Possibilities include:delicious- by using shared stacks, and ability to add links via email- instapaper - by using RSS feed from account
- posterous
- tumblr
- An actual site
The suggestion of 3rd party sites/applications is all just to avoid bolting on a poorly thought out system for one-off item additions in newswire itself.

Spent too long testing out delicious, couldn't get links to post via email, and stacks appear to not have feeds, only accounts.
Instapaper items saved via the email feature don't appear in the RSS.
Leaving instapaper on the list because it provides the same functionality, and is more straightforward.
I'd really like to get more info on the workflows of people who would be doing these one-off additions though.
